Moose Muhammad Makes Crazy Catch for Texas A&M Football
There's been offensive fits and starts for Texas A&M football during this game; big chunks picked up and times the offense has stalled (mostly in the red zone so far). The Aggies have had some great play calls and plays made by a skeleton crew, however, and this catch by Mooses Muhammad is likely the best yet.

I love how you can hear Mike Elko (the new Texas A&M football head man was being interviewed in the booth at this moment) congratulate Moose on the catch as it's made. It's really the icing on the cake here.
Let's be real, though: it's pretty much a 50/50 proposition that if Moose sees adequate playing time in a given game, he will make some kind of stellar grab at one point or another. He just has a penchant for doing it whenever he's out there. He's a true playmaker at the receiver spot, which drives home even more the importance of keeping him around for next year. If he is in the receiver room, he will be an absolute linchpin of the position group.
Before long, I'll be able to make a top 10 list of Moose Muhammad catches. He just keeps making incredible grabs every time he has the opportunity. This can be a blessing and a curse at times, as he sometimes goes for the spectacular play rather than the sure one, but he continues to astound with his sheer ability to make these eye-popping grabs.
Texas A&M football currently trails 17-6. The Cowboys have made it into the Aggie red zone on every drive but one, and have scored on two out of four. The Aggies need a big stop here, and maybe just a bit more of Moose's wizardry when the offense gets back out there.
